Vertical blind weights are essential components of vertical blinds that help keep the slats in place and maintain their shape. They are typically located at the bottom of each slat and ensure that the blinds hang straight and do not sway in the wind. Without these weights, your vertical blinds may look messy and unappealing. Additionally, the weights help the blinds to move effortlessly when opening and closing, providing you with easy light and privacy control.

The chains on vertical blinds are another crucial element that allows you to easily adjust the slats to let in or block out light. The chains are connected to the weights at the bottom of each slat and can be used to tilt the slats open or closed. By simply pulling on the chain, you can control the amount of light entering the room and adjust the level of privacy. The chains on vertical blinds are typically made from durable materials like plastic or metal to ensure smooth operation and longevity.

It’s important to properly maintain the vertical blind weights and chains to ensure the smooth operation of your blinds. Over time, the weights may become dirty or damaged, which can affect the overall appearance and functionality of the blinds. Regular cleaning and inspection of the weights can help prevent any issues and prolong the life of your vertical blinds. Additionally, if you notice any damage or wear and tear on the chains, it’s important to replace them as soon as possible to prevent any further damage to the blinds.

When choosing vertical blind weights and chains for your window treatments, it’s important to select high-quality materials that are durable and reliable. Cheap or flimsy weights and chains may not provide the support and functionality that your blinds need, leading to potential issues down the line. Look for weights that are heavy enough to keep the slats in place but not too heavy that they weigh down the blinds. Similarly, opt for chains that are strong and smooth to ensure easy operation and longevity.

In addition to selecting the right materials, it’s also important to ensure that the vertical blind weights and chains are properly installed. If the weights are not secured correctly, they may come loose and cause the blinds to tilt or sway. Similarly, if the chains are not aligned properly, they may not move smoothly, resulting in difficulty when adjusting the slats. If you’re unsure about how to install or replace the weights and chains, it’s best to consult a professional to ensure that your vertical blinds are in optimal condition.
